This full-time position under the director of the Health and Human Services director, is responsible for providing direct patient care at our tribal health center. Position will provide oversight of medical programs operations by ensuring quality healthcare is delivered through the entire life span. Provides strategic guidance. The position assists in maintaining the daily operations of the clinical settings to meet patient medical needs and expectations. The position is responsible for medical decisions or care provided to patients on a daily basis and providing medical oversight and assistance to nursing personnel assigned to your patient care team.

Qualifications:

Possess a Medical Doctor (MD) or Doctor of Osteopathic Medicine (OD) with professional board certification. Family practice preferred but will consider Internal Medicine/Pediatrics. Must be currently licensed, in good standing, in the State of Michigan or ability to obtain by date of hire required. Possess a current and valid DEA license. Valid MI. driver's license (in compliance with HIC insurance carrier) and dependable transportation required. BLS certification required or ability to obtain after hire, required. Must have no previous suspensions or revocations of license. Clinical practice experience required; 5 or more years preferred. Oral communication skills to communicate with patients and other health care professionals.
